ISO/TS 23359:2025

Nanotechnologies
Chemical characterization of graphene in in powders and suspensions

Summary

The document describes methods for characterising the chemical properties of powders or liquid dispersions containing graphene-related two-dimensional materials, using a set of suitable measurement techniques. The techniques detailed are X-ray photoelectron spectroscopy (XPS), inductively coupled plasma mass spectrometry (ICP-MS), thermogravimetric analysis (TGA) and Fourier-transform infrared spectroscopy (FTIR). These determine the carbon-to-oxygen ratio, elemental composition, trace metal impurities, weight percentage of chemical species and the functional groups present. The sample preparation, protocols and data analysis for the different techniques are included.
